What a corporate account actually is
A corporate account replaces one-off credit-card charges with a monthly invoice tied to your firm. Traveller profiles save preferences (vehicle class, pickup instructions, preferred chauffeur). Reporting breaks rides out by cost centre, matter number, or traveller.
Setup timeline
Sign a one-page agreement. We activate within one business day, upload traveller profiles, and give your EAs a booking channel of their choice (email, phone, or portal).
SLA and priority
Corporate accounts get priority dispatch, guaranteed vehicle class, and a named account manager. During heavy-demand periods (holidays, major events), corporate rides are protected first.
Billing details EAs care about
Itemized monthly PDF invoice, CSV export, per-cost-center breakdown, and configurable approval workflows. Split billing supported for firms that recharge clients.
Frequently asked questions
Is there a minimum spend?
No — accounts are open to firms of any size.
Can we specify a preferred chauffeur?
Yes, when they're available. Reliability comes first, then preference.
